Cellularity of generalized Schur algebras via Cauchy decomposition

Published 7 Feb 2020 in math.RT | (2002.02932v1)

Abstract: We describe a generalization of Hashimoto and Kurano's Cauchy filtration for divided powers algebras. This filtration is then used to provide a cellular structure for generalized Schur algebras associated to an arbitrary cellular algebra. Applications to the cellularity of wreath product algebras $A \wr \mathfrak{S}_d$ are also considered.
